Effects of Forest Disturbance on Particulate Organic Matter Budgets of Small Streams

Abstract: Organic matter dynamics were studied in five streams at Coweeta Hydrologic Laboratory. Three of these streams drained logged watersheds, and two drained reference deciduous forest watersheds. Litter inputs to the streams draining disturbed watersheds were significantly lower than to reference streams. Additionally, while undisturbed litterfall consisted primarily of relatively refractory leaf species, litterfall in the disturbed watersheds was composed of more labile leaf material. “…However, removal of riparian forest may adversely affect thermal regime (see reviews in Morash 2001, Steedman et al 2004), inputs of fine organic matter (Webster and Waide 1982, Webster et al 1990, Hartman et al 1996, and recruitment of coarse woody material (Dolloff and Webster 2000, Meleason et al 2003, Jones andDaniels 2008). Stream temperature typically is influenced by forest within 10 to 30 m of shorelines depending on tree height and canopy density (Barton et al 1985, Castelle et al 1994, Sridhar et al 2004, Wilkerson et al 2006).…”
